    Directions: In the following questions, two equations numbered I and II have been given. You have to solve both the equations and mark the correct answer.
    I. \[2{{x}^{2}}+23x+63=0\]  
    II. \[4{{y}^{2}}+19y+21=0\]

    A) If \[x<y\]

    B) If \[x>y\]

    C) If \[x\ge y\]                    

    D) If \[x\le y\]

    E) If relationship between \[x\] and \[y\] cannot be established

    Correct Answer: A

    Solution :

    I. \[2{{x}^{2}}+23x+63=0\]
    \[\Rightarrow \]\[2{{x}^{2}}+14x+9x+63=0\]
    \[\Rightarrow \]\[2x\,\,(x+7)+9\,\,(x+7)=0\]
    \[\Rightarrow \]   \[(x+7)(2x+9=0\]
    \[\Rightarrow \]   \[x=-\,\,7,\]\[x=-\frac{9}{2}\]
    II. \[4{{y}^{2}}+19y+21=0\]
    \[\Rightarrow \]\[4{{y}^{2}}+12y+7y-21=0\]
    \[\Rightarrow \]\[4y\,\,(y+3)+7\,\,(y+3)=0\]
    \[\Rightarrow \] \[(y+3)(4y+7)=0\] \[\Rightarrow \] \[y=-\,\,3,\]\[y=-\frac{7}{4}\]
    \[\therefore \]      \[y>x\]
